Kalpatharu Institute of Technology KCET Cutoff Trends

Kalpatharu Institute of Technology KCET Cutoff Trends show that 2024 was a more relaxing year compared to 2023 for the Artificial Intelligence Course. KCET 2022 Cutoff for courses like Civil Engineering, 2024 was challenging compared to 2022 and 2023, respectively. Kalpatharu Institute of Technology KCET Cutoff for Civil Engineering is 158833 for 2024, 203000 for 2023 and 172089 for 2022. Computer Science Engineering Course became the most popular course with the highest cutoff. KCET Computer Science Engineering Cutoff for Kalpatharu Institute of Technology is 61,887 for 2024, 45,974 for 2023 and 37,832 for 2022, which means 2022 was challenging, followed by 2023 and 2024. Kalpatharu Institute of Technology KCET Cutoff Trends for GM Category Round

The table below contains the Kalpatharu Institute of Technology GM Category Round 1 KCET Cutoff for 2024, 2023a and 2022.

Name of the Course

2024

2023

2022

Artificial Intelligence

77,870

63,362

-

Civil Engineering

1,58,833

2,03,000

1,72,089

Computer Science Engineering

61,887

45,974

37,832

Electronics and Communication Engineering

89,026

73,986

70,063

Information Science Engineering

70,740

58,588

54,036

Mechanical Engineering

17,0731

2,03,066

1,56,885

​K alpatharu Institute of Technology KCET Cutoff Trends For GM Category Round 2

The table below contains the Kalpatharu Institute of Technology GM Category Round 2 KCET Cutoff for 2024, 2023 and 2022.

Name of the Course

2024

2023

2022

Artificial Intelligence

94,011

73,298

-

Civil Engineering

2,73,771

1,99,587

1,50,078

Computer Science Engineering

80,498

50,716

41,804

Electronics and Communication Engineering

1,10,544

82,761

77,255

Information Science Engineering

94,203

60,782

54,537

Mechanical Engineering

2,63,066

2,03,066

1,56,885

How is the KCET exam rank calculated?

Calculating the KCET 2025 rank comprises averaging your scores from both the KCET 2025 exam and your Class 12 board exam (PCM subjects). Each component carries 50% weightage and your final KCET rank is based on this composite score.
